The IRS may choose to review a taxpayer's accounts and financial information to ensure all tax laws are being followed. When you get ready to prepare your taxes, you may be concerned about making a mistake or doing anything else that could trigger an IRS tax audit. Even though the IRS only audited 0.4% of individual income tax returns in 2019, many taxpayers live in fear of a letter from the IRS questioning items on their return. Do yourself a favor and try to file the return the right way the first time and reduce your chances of receiving an IRS notice or even minimize your chances of winning the IRS audit lottery. This book will explain how the IRS selects many returns for audit along with 41 different tax errors or goofs that people make every year and keep you from being a bigger target for an IRS audit.

For anyone who has had to endure an IRS audit-or hopes they never will-Beating the IRS Tax Squeeze is the story of one woman's journey through an IRS tax audit that lasted five years. Qian Yi began to chronicle her interactions with the Internal Revenue Service soon after her third office audit on December 5, 2002, shortly after she had returned from Shanghai with her husband. By that point, the audit on their 2000 tax return had been going on for twenty months, with eight intimidating IRS CP notices and three office audits-the tax assessment on her and her husband's joint 2000 tax return having escalated from approximately $9,000 to a whopping $78,000. All the while, from the very beginning, Qian arduously negotiated with the IRS and hoped for a quick resolution, but it was everything but quick. Never could Qian have foreseen that their 2000 tax return audit could drag on for five years and that while it was still pending for a resolution, all their tax returns for years 2001, 2002, 2003, 2004, and even 2005 would all come under IRS's unrelenting and unremitting scrutiny. In this smart, worldly, and candid book, Qian adheres to the facts of her dealings with the IRS as she recounts her many telephone calls, multiple correspondence audits, and five office audits. Her uplifting tale of survival proves that perseverance is the key-only if you believe you are right-to success with IRS audits and, perhaps, in all aspects of life.
